Inez E. Kupsky, age 89 of Shawano, passed away Thursday, April 26, 2012 at the Evergreen Care Center in Shawano. Born on December 18, 1922 in Ft. Lauderdale, FL, she was the 2nd of eight children born to Herman and Marian (Estey) Gebert. After high school, Inez attended the St. John's College in Winfield, KS and in 1944 moved to Bonduel where she taught the lower grades at St. Paul Lutheran School for three years. Inez met her future husband, Eldon Kupsky through the church youth group and often joked that she picked him for his mother, Alma (nee Luebker) Kupsky. The couple was united in marriage at St. Paul Evangelical Lutheran Church in Bonduel on Easter Sunday, April 6, 1947. After marriage they lived with his parents until they were able to buy a small farm of their own in the Town of Hartland, where they raised their five children. As the children grew Inez taught for one year in the early fifties and then taught the fourth grade from 1961 until her health forced her to retire in 1973. Inez and Eldon both loved woodworking and even remodeled an old log barn on the farm as a woodworking shop. While she did help Eldon with some of the larger projects such as furniture and remodeling, Inez loved making toys for children. For many years the house smelled of wood and varnish during the last weeks before Christmas as she rushed to get projects done. She also enjoyed planting flowers all over her yard to complement the many trees that Eldon planted. She loved people and sought to share the love of her Savior, Jesus Christ, with everyone she came in contact with. She was active in the Lutheran Women's Missionary League and worked at the Bethesda Lutheran resale store in Green Bay as long as her heath allowed. She and Eldon were the congregational representatives for the Lutheran Church Extension Fund and as such she was known as "the stamp lady" by many students at St. Paul Lutheran School. She had been a resident of Evergreen Care Center in Shawano since July 2007.
